Israel Aerospace Industries (IAI) said it signed a contract valued at over $200 million to provide Special Mission Aircraft to a country in Europe, which is a NATO member country. The Special Mission Aircraft will be developed by IAIs Group and subsidiary ELTA Systems
Russian Helicopters (RH) and Rosoboronexport (ROE) have signed a contract with a foreign customer to deliver a batch of modernized Mi-171E helicopters. The upgraded Mi-171Es are distinguished by an improved power plant and increased carrying capacity

Israels Rafael said it will present its new Ice Breaker air-to-surface missile at the upcoming Farnborough International Airshow (July 18-22) in the UK. The 5th generation long-range, autonomous, precision-guided missile system enables significant attack performance against a variety of high-value land, and sea targets
Pakistan Navys second Type 054A/P frigate Taimur has joined Peoples Liberation Army Navy (PLAN) warships in the ongoing Sea Guardians-2 joint naval drills off Shanghai. An opening ceremony was held at a naval port in Wusong, Shanghai on Sunday, state-owned China Central Television (CCTV) reported on the day

Aviation Industry Corporation of China (AVIC) on June 29 rolled out a Wing Loong-2 drone designed to monitor the weather, instead of performing airstrikes. A variant of the Wing Loong 2 military reconnaissance/strike combat drone already serves the Ministry of Emergency Management with disaster assessment with onboard sensors and restoring telecommunications
